What is the correct spelling for DISONANT?

If you're referring to the word "disonant", the correct spelling is actually "dissonant". "Dissonant" is an adjective used to describe sounds that are harsh, lacking harmony or inharmonious. It is important to ensure accuracy in spelling to convey the intended meaning effectively.
